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
26 8439 55795781 7085924
930383626 83
930383626 83
05678677324 94 8427
All about undefined
Interested in learning more?
930383626 83
05678677324 94 8427
See more
644283359 50
4216 036868 7024
See more
428519046 56516 849554074
80552311 358 197008883
See more